Обзор продукта: HighCapacity Primary Jaw Crusher for Granite and Basalt Processing
Этот продукт предназначен для тяжелых условий эксплуатации, stationary primary jaw crusher designed for the initial reduction of hard, абразивные материалы, такие как гранит, базальт, и речной гравий. Its operational workflow is engineered for maximum uptime:
1. Потребление корма: Large dump loads are received via a vibrating grizzly feeder, which bypasses sub50mm fines to increase primary crushing efficiency.
2. Первичное сокращение: Material is crushed between a fixed and a mechanically actuated moving jaw plate with high kinetic energy.
3. Увольнять & Транспортировка: Crushed material exits at the bottom discharge point at a preset closedside setting (CSS), directly conveyed to secondary screening or crushing stages.
Область применения: Ideal for largescale quarry primary crushing stations and major infrastructure project mobile plants. Ограничения: Not designed for recycling applications with high levels of rebar or for ultrafine grinding; secondary or tertiary cone/impact crushers are required for final product shaping.

Технические характеристики
Обозначение модели: JC1400HD
Кормовое отверстие: 1400mm x 1100mm
Максимальный размер подачи: 1000мм длина кромки
Recommended Closed Side Setting (CSS) Диапазон: 150mm 280mm
Диапазон мощности: 450 950 т/ч (в зависимости от исходного материала & CSS)
Требования к мощности привода: 200 кВт (Гидростатическая система привода)
Общий вес (Только дробилка): ~78,000 kg
Конструкция основной рамы: Закаленный & Tempered Steel Casting
Jaw Plates Material: Manganese Steel with optional ceramic inserts
Диапазон рабочих температур: 30°С до +45°С
